Consumer Electronics Training — Key Modules
Gain hands-on expertise across firmware, mechanical design, IoT, and manufacturing — covering the full product development cycle.
Embedded Firmware & Microcontroller Programming
Develop, debug, and optimize embedded firmware using C/C++ for microcontroller-based CE systems.
BIOS, UEFI & Hardware Abstraction
Understand low-level firmware architecture, boot processes, and hardware interface layers for CE devices.
Communication Protocols & Peripheral Integration
Implement I2C, SPI, UART, and Modbus protocols for seamless device communication.
PCB Design & Signal Integrity
Design high-speed PCB layouts and ensure signal reliability using Altium, Eagle, and KiCAD.
Power Electronics & Motor Control Firmware
Develop firmware for BLDC motors and power electronics in consumer-grade applications.
Mechanical Design & CAD Modeling
Create 3D CAD models, plastic enclosures, and assemblies optimized for manufacturability.
AI, ML & IoT for Smart Devices
Integrate AI models and IoT architectures to enable connected, intelligent consumer electronics.
Thermal & Structural Simulation
Simulate thermal performance and structural strength of CE housings and components using CAE tools.
Sensor Data Analytics & Computer Vision
Build computer vision and data processing systems for automation and product monitoring.
Prototyping, Testing & Virtual Validation
Develop digital prototypes and perform verification through hardware-in-loop and simulation testing.
Industry 4.0 & Smart Factory Digitalization
Adopt MES, ERP, and automation technologies for digitally integrated CE production.
Manufacturing & Quality Systems (FMEA, SPC, 7QC)
Apply process quality frameworks for defect prevention and production consistency.
